Output 18ddaeb85c9009e4f9f2122f9a0bf5694c0be0da5ac18223db070b71c18d555a:0

value
32917278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cd272447e1258ce54bd223a9b37613413051ae2 OP_EQUAL
address
3EXcdUAv7nSvS7ceVfX7tKnXHWW8UuqSbv
transaction
18ddaeb85c9009e4f9f2122f9a0bf5694c0be0da5ac18223db070b71c18d555a
spent
true